The SL4 has to be the smallest and brightest 4 "C" cell dive light ever made! It emits a narrow and penetrating beam, which allows you to seek out unique marine life found under ledges. It also works well when attached to protective head gear in technical diving applications. The SL4 is great as a photo spotting light or to illuminate gauges and dive tables. Light fits neatly in a BCD pocket so it's always ready for use with its 5.5 watt high pressure xenon filled lamp. Tough, non-conductive ABS and polycarbonate plastic construction will not corrode dent or freeze to skin in cold weather, and it comes with an Adjustable Rubber Sleeved Lanyard.

The SL4's Xenon Lamp produces 113 Lumens of Brightness with a Precision Machined Aluminum Reflector that gives a tight 8-Degree Beam Angle. To reduce glare and protect the light, the SL4 comes with a Molded Rubber Bezel Cover. The Rotary Switch is easily activated with the thumb and index finger for single hand operation. The Light is powered by 4 x C"-Cell Alkaline Batteries (included) with a Burn Time of 4 to 5 Hours. The light measures 6.3" x 1.8" x 2.5" (16 x 4.57 x 6.35 cm), weighs 15 oz (425.24 g) and is Depth Rated to 500' (152.4 meters).
